Is financial analysis a hard skill?

Technical training, financial literacy, accounting knowledge, and analytics training are among the hard skills required for Financial Analysts. They should also possess soft skills such as critical thinking, clear communication, problem-solving, and leadership.

What is the basic knowledge of financial analysis?

Financial analysis is the process of evaluating businesses, projects, budgets, and other finance-related transactions to determine their performance and suitability. Typically, financial analysis is used to analyze whether an entity is stable, solvent, liquid, or profitable enough to warrant a monetary investment.

Are Financial Analysts in high demand?

The job outlook for Financial Analysts is strong, with a projected 9% growth rate from 2021 to 2031, partly due to anticipated increases in economic activity and the emergence of industries requiring financial knowledge.

What software does financial analyst use?

Microsoft Excel

Many finance professionals use this industry-standard spreadsheet app for financial modeling. Excel allows users to create Excel models using integrated data. It's also helpful for performing subroutines, array functions, and user-defined VBA functions.

What does a financial analyst do all day?

In general, financial analysts analyze the financial statements of companies to determine good investments, they analyze stocks, bonds, and other financial instruments. Financial analysts help determine the value of mergers and acquisitions. They study economic data, the financial markets, and recommend investments.

Can you be a financial analyst without a CFA?

Become a chartered financial analyst: Financial analysts do not need CFA certification to work in the field, but these credentials can improve their employment chances and earning potential. The CFA requires a combined 4,000 hours of education and experience.

What is an example of a financial analysis?

Financial analysis example

One example of a financial analysis would be if a financial analyst calculated your company's profitability ratios, which assess your company's ability to make money, and leverage ratios, which measure your company's ability to pay off its debts.
